Abstract
The authors propose a versatile point process as a model for a large class of variable bit rate sources and their superpositions. The process belongs to the class of discrete-time batch Markovian arrival processes. Its use leads to computationally tractable and accurate solutions for the following performance measures of the related statistical multiplexer: buffer occupancy distribution, cell loss probability, and conditional cell loss probability. It is shown that the output process of the multiplexer belongs to the same class of processes.
